High school baseball: Six Webster Parish players named to Louisiana Baseball Coaches Association’s All-State teams

by Russell Hedges

Six players from Webster Parish schools have been named to the Louisiana Baseball Coaches Association’s All-State teams.

They are North Webster’s Collin McKenzie (Class 3A), Lakeside’s Jon Jon Dick (Class 2A), and Glenbrook’s Hayden Harmon, Cason Clemons, Maddox Mandino and Easton Sanders (Class 1A).

McKenzie, a 2023 graduate, made the team as an infielder.

He batted .549 with 50 hits, including 13 doubles and one triple, and 28 RBI.

McKenzie was also a pitcher. He went 4-3 with a 3.355 ERA and had 62 strikeouts in 56 1/3 innings.

Dick, a rising junior, made the team at designated hitter. He batted .434 with 15 doubles, one triple, one home run and 32 RBI. 

Harmon, a 2023 graduate, made the team at pitcher. He was 8-1 with an ERA of 2.724. He struck out 83 in 61 2/3 innings.

Clemons, a 2023 graduate, made team at infielder. He batted .322 with seven doubles, one triple and 12 RBI.

Mandino, a 2023 graduate, made the team at outfielder. He batted .466 with 12 doubles, six triples, four home runs and 26 RBI.

Sanders, a rising junior, made the team at utility. A pitcher and infielder, he was 6-1 with a 2.763 ERA. He struck out 54 in 38 innings.

Sanders batted .354 with seven doubles, four home runs and 31 RBI.
